Advances in nano‐/microfabrication allow the fabrication of biomimetic substrates for various biomedical applications. In particular, it would be beneficial to control the distribution of cells and relevant biomolecules on an extracellular matrix (ECM)‐like substrate with arbitrary micropatterns. In this regard, the possibilities of patterning biomolecules and cells on nanofibrous matrices are explored...
With the assistance of an ink‐jet printer, solvent (the “ink”) can be controllably and reproducibly printed onto electrospun nanofiber meshes (the “paper”) to generate various micropatterns and subsequently guide distinct cellular organization and phenotype expression.
